Monthly Cost of Living

A single person spends $932 per month in Chiang Mai vs $971 in Hartebeespoort, rent included.

A couple spends around $1,399 per month in Chiang Mai vs $1,511 in Hartebeespoort, rent included.

A family of three spends $1,866 per month in Chiang Mai vs $2,052 in Hartebeespoort, rent included.

Chiang Mai is about 4% cheaper than Hartebeespoort,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.

Both Chiang Mai and Hartebeespoort are more affordable than the global median – Chiang Mai 32% lower, Hartebeespoort 29% lower.

Cost Breakdown

A central one-bedroom costs $490 in Chiang Mai versus $254 in Hartebeespoort.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.

Salaries run about 249% higher in Hartebeespoort,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.

A mid-range dinner for two costs $20.00 in Chiang Mai versus $39.00 in Hartebeespoort. Groceries tell a different story – $241 in Chiang Mai vs $177 in Hartebeespoort – so Hartebeespoort wins on supermarket bills even if dining out costs more.
